Abstract

This thesis addresses the issue of generator protection systems in hydroelectric power plants. The primary objective is to design the configuration and settings of generator protection functions using the REX640 Intelligent Electronic Device (IED) from ABB, followed by the verification of these settings using the Omicron CMC 500 test set. The thesis analyses the extent to which this multi-application relay can replace specialized generator protection units. The theoretical part is devoted to the analysis of the most common fault conditions of synchronous generators and the principles of their detection. The practical part then describes in detail the specific design of the protection scheme, the calculation of protection function parameters, and the methods of testing to verify their correct operation.
